Ingredients

Scale
  • 500g boneless and skinless chicken thighs
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1-inch piece of ginger, minced
  • 3 cups chicken broth
  • 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ch mixed with 2 tablespoons water
  • 1 cup jasmine rice
  • 2 cups water (for rice)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Sliced green onions for garnish

Instructions

  1. Cut chicken thighs into bite-sized pieces; season lightly with salt and pepper.
  2. In a bowl, mix soy sauce, sesame oil, garlic, ginger, and brown sugar. Marinate chicken for 10 minutes.
  3. Rinse jasmine rice until water runs clear. In a saucepan, boil 2 cups water; add rice. Cover and simmer for 15 minutes until cooked.
  4. In a large pot, heat oil over medium-high heat; sauté marinated chicken for 5-7 minutes until caramelized.
  5. Pour in chicken broth and rice vinegar; bring to boil and then reduce to simmer.
  6. Add cornstarch mixture gradually while stirring to thicken the broth; simmer for an additional 5 minutes.
  7. Adjust seasoning as needed before serving over rice.
